Peer-To-Peer Network Security

Thursday September 30, 2004
While Senator Hatch and the RIAA would have you believe that P2P networking is nothing but a cesspool of pedophiles and song-swapping criminals, the federal courts seem to feel otherwise. There are legal and legitimate uses for file sharing networks, however extreme caution should be exercised in judging the security of exposing your computer to the outside world or installing files from unknown sources. This article provides some tips and hints to help you use P2P networks securely: Peer-to-Peer Network Security.
